UK Space Conference 2023

25/09/2023

The UK Space Conference 2023 is happening on 21-23 November in Belfast with the theme 'Space For Our Future'. The event is being held at the ICC Belfast conference centre in the city center (BT1 3WH) and will bring together governments, industry, and academia. There are three main tracks in this year's content programme: DISCOVER (exploring the potential of space), GROW (highlighting the opportunities of data and AI), and SECURE (ensuring the future-proofing of space assets and services). The conference also includes exhibitors, networking events, and a Gala Dinner.

This biennial event is a significant gathering for the UK Space sector, attracting both UK and international space communities. The conference provides an opportunity for space sector professionals to exchange ideas, develop plans and partnerships, and encourage success in the emerging space age.
